SYSLOG Commands
logging on
Use the logging on Global Configuration mode command to enable message
logging. This command sends debug or error messages asynchronously to
designated locations. Use the no form of this command to disable the
logging.
Syntax
logging on
no logging on
Parameters
N/A
Default Configuration
Message logging is enabled.
Command Mode
Global Configuration mode
User Guidelines

Example
The following example enables logging error messages.
console(config)# logging on
